Everyone talks about how a baby changes your body — but no one talks enough about how deeply it can change your marriage and relationships. In this honest and emotionally raw episode of the Womb & Word Podcast, host Kim sits down with licensed therapist, couples counselor, and parental mental health specialist Jennifer C. Williams to unpack the realities many couples silently experience after having a baby. Together, they discuss postpartum loneliness, emotional disconnect, communication struggles, sleep deprivation, intimacy after baby, postpartum depression in both mothers and fathers, and how parenthood can shift identity, partnership, and emotional connection. Jennifer shares practical insight on how couples can create emotional safety, communicate more effectively during stressful seasons, navigate postpartum changes together, and reconnect even when life feels overwhelming. This episode is a reminder that struggling after baby does not mean your relationship is failing — and that support, grace, honest communication, and community matter more than perfection.
